Android WebView: make use of host multilib support.

Set the gyp variables that control the use of the Android build system's
host multilib support so that we can:
1) not break host multilib builds
2) correctly specify whether we want our host binaries to be build as 32
   or 64 bit, fixing Mac host builds of V8 for 64-bit targets.
